Description
The ServiceNow Solutions Architect reports to the Platform Operations Manager, and is responsible for the design, implementation, maintenance, operations, and improvement of the technical tools and systems supporting IT Service Management functions for a large infrastructure support program. Essential duties of this position include:
Primary interface to integration partners for the efficient, effective integration of tools and exchange of information with other peer teams, vendors, and 3rd parties including Cloud providers
Workflow design, management and orchestration between tools and groups
High-availability and fault tolerant design and implementation of tools
The ideal candidate will have extensive experience in ServiceNow deployment, design, architecture, and operations including customer portal, Service Asset and Configuration Management (SACM), Project Portfolio Management, Service Mapping, Knowledge Management, and integrations with 3rd parties and tools.
Other key attributes include:
Ability to lead / assist with formulation and definition of solution scope and objectives while working with a team of Developers / Analysts on functional requirements and specifications.
Ability to use Object Oriented Design and Unit Testing / Test Driven Development techniques to design, code, test, debug, and document the automation services.
Independently performs and assists other team members in providing ongoing system maintenance, research, problem resolution, and on-call support tasks for existing systems.
Conducts investigations of considerable complexity.
Able to provide guidance and training to less-experienced programmer/analysts.
With limited direction, supports the implementation of systems into production.
Researches emerging technologies to determine impact on existing services and identify improvement opportunities.
Experience with agile software lifecycle processes; version control methodologies and tools
Qualifications
REQUIRED EDUCATION AND EXPERIENCE:
Must have a Bachelors and Nine (9) years or more experience; Masters and seven (7) years or more experience. Will accept an additional 4 years of experience in lieu of a degree.
Must have at least 4 years of direct ServiceNow experience.
Must have experience working on complex ServiceNow issues.
Must be able to work in a team environment.
Must be able to lead and help younger team members solve more complex problems.
Must have experience with: JavaScript, SOAP & REST Web Services, UI/UX design, Angular JS, HTML, Bootstrap, JSON, JQuery, Structured Query Language (SQL)
ITIL certification preferred (Foundation or above)
Desired Qualifications
Experience with related tools and platforms including Identity Access and Management (CyberARK, SailPoint), Microsoft Active Directory, Splunk, and VMWare platforms is a plus.Overview
